MINUTES — Management Meeting, Orvath Manufacturing

Attendees: ops, finance, sales leadership. Topic: Kestwick plant capacity.

Decided: add a third shift rather than expand floor space. Capex deferred twelve months. Sales leads must not promise delivery under six weeks on Duralon orders until the shift is staffed. Hiring starts immediately; target is forty operators by quarter-end. Forecasts due to ops weekly. Questions route through the plant director. The confidential planning note this decision supports appears directly below.

internal memo for kawip-hadug: Headcount on the Wenwyn team goes from 7 to 140 by the end of January. Gross margin on Wenwyn came in at 20 percent against a plan of 15 percent.

Subject: Encoding detection — new owner

Hi! Small reshuffle on Textgleam: the charset-detection module for uploaded text files (the BOM sniffing, the confidence fallbacks, all the fun edge cases) has a new owner as of this sprint. Please route those review requests accordingly. Here's who'll be approving changes going forward.

named custodian: Brivan Eliath Quenox Frador

## Approvals: Snapshot Tests

Snapshot updates for the Driftwell UI kit require approval before merge. On-call: never bulk-accept snapshot diffs during an incident; revert instead. Single-component updates need one approval; cross-component updates need a design check too. CI blocks merges with unapproved snapshot changes. If you're paged about a blocked release, route the diff to the designated approver. The approver's full name is listed below.

account owner for fajep-yagef: Kasix Eliiel

## Changelog — Font vendoring defaults changed

As of this release, the Bracken UI build no longer fetches third-party fonts at build time. All typefaces used by the Lanternwell suite are now vendored into the repo under a dedicated assets directory, and the fetch step is skipped by default. If you're onboarding, nothing to install — the fonts travel with the checkout. The build flags controlling this behavior are listed below.

settings of hadup-yafog:
LAMAEL_PIN=3761
LAMAEL_TENANT=istmir
LAMAEL_METRICS_HOST=metrics.lamael.plorvasys.test
LAMAEL_SEAL=seal_8ea68500
LAMAEL_STANDBY_TEAM=fraok